Section 12 of the Tobacco Products Act in conjunction with Section 9 of the Tobacco Products Ordinance
Novel tobacco products, for example heated tobacco products, may only be placed on the market if they have been approved. You can apply for approval from the Federal Office of Consumer Protection and Food Safety (BVL).
In Germany, novel tobacco products may only be placed on the market if they have been approved. The legislator defines novel tobacco products as tobacco products that
- do not fall into one of the following categories:
- Cigarettes,
- roll-your-own tobacco,
- pipe tobacco,
- water pipe tobacco,
- cigars,
- cigarillos,
- chewing tobacco,
- snuff and
- tobacco for oral use;
- and which are placed on the market after May 19, 2014.
E-cigarettes and herbal smoking products, for example herbal cigarettes, are not tobacco products and therefore not novel tobacco products within the meaning of this definition.
If your company produces novel tobacco products or imports them to Germany and intends to place them on the market in Germany, you must apply for approval for these products from the Federal Office of Consumer Protection and Food Safety (BVL).
The authorization also includes a statement as to whether the novel tobacco product is a smoking tobacco product or a smokeless tobacco product.
The authorization can be revoked if your tobacco product no longer meets the legal requirements.
The authorization does not release you from fulfilling the legal requirements, including the notification of the products in the EU Common Entry Gate (EU-CEG) notification portal.
Please enclose the following documents in electronic form with your German-language application in accordance with Section 9 (2) of the Tobacco Products Ordinance:
- Name, address and electronic contact details of the manufacturer or importer,
- Description of the novel tobacco product, instructions for use and information on ingredients and emissions as well as the analytical methods and measurement procedures used,
- available scientific studies on toxicity, addictive effects and attractiveness of the novel tobacco product, in particular with regard to its ingredients and emissions
- available studies on market research and on the preferences of the consumer groups concerned with regard to ingredients and emissions, as well as summaries of the market studies they carry out on the occasion of the launch of new tobacco products; and
- other available information, including a risk-benefit analysis of the novel tobacco product, its expected impact on tobacco cessation and initiation, and expected consumer perceptions.
The listed annexes to the application are also accepted in English.
If there are changes in the composition, if new studies are available or if the BVL requests further information, you must submit this immediately.

- The application must be submitted by the manufacturer or importer.
The product subject to the application must meet the requirements of tobacco law.
You can apply for admission online via the federal portal.
Apply for admission online via the federal portal:
- Call up the online application on the federal portal verwaltung.bund.de. This will guide you step by step through the necessary information, which you can enter electronically.
- Upload the required documents as a file and submit the application.
- The BVL will check your information and documents and contact you if further documents or information are required. Please note that the processing time will be longer if the application documents are incomplete. As processing is only possible after all relevant information has been submitted, you will be asked to submit additional documents if necessary.
- You will receive a notification of admission digitally via the federal portal or by post.
- You will also receive a separate notification of fees with a request for payment.
If you are unable to submit the application via the federal portal, please contact the BVL at poststelle@bvl.bund.de.
The following information is available:
An application for authorization does not replace the legal requirements generally applicable to tobacco products, including notification requirements (EU-CEG). The notification of a product in EU-CEG as a novel tobacco product does not constitute an application for authorization.
To ensure a smooth process, make sure that the application documents, including the notification in the EU-CEG, are complete at the time of application.

- Authorization of novel tobacco products Issue
- Novel tobacco products may only be placed on the market if they have been authorized
- Authorization requirement applies to each individual product or variety
- Authorization is subject to compliance with the legal requirements
- Authorization must be applied for
- Fees: EUR 8,500 to EUR 11,200
- Processing time: usually 6 to 12 months
- Applications can be submitted:
- online via the federal portal
- responsible: Federal Office of Consumer Protection and Food Safety in agreement with the Federal Office of Economics and Export Control
